Home to appMobi XDK the world’s first cloud-powered mobile application development environment.
Cost / License
- Free
- Proprietary
Platforms
- Android
- iPhone
- iPad
B4X is described as 'Cross platform development tools for native iOS, Android, desktop and server applications. B4X is a Rapid Application Development (RAD) tool for real world apps. The programming language is a modern version of Visual Basic' and is a popular IDE in the development category. There are more than 50 alternatives to B4X for a variety of platforms, including Windows, Linux, Mac, Android and iPhone apps. The best B4X alternative is Microsoft Visual Studio. It's not free, so if you're looking for a free alternative, you could try Microsoft Visual Studio or Eclipse. Other great apps like B4X are Android Studio, Qt Creator, Lazarus and Code::Blocks.
Home to appMobi XDK the world’s first cloud-powered mobile application development environment.
RubyMotion is an implementation of the Ruby programming language that runs on Android, iOS and OS X. RubyMotion is a commercial product created by Laurent Sansonetti for HipByte and is based on MacRuby for OS X.
Mobile App Development Platform for non-developers: create native apps; send to devices or submit to app stores; manage apps from a secure CMS.




Gambas is a full-featured object language and development environment built on a BASIC interpreter. It is released under the GNU General Public Licence. Its architecture is largely inspired by Java. Gambas is made up of: a compiler, an interpreter, an archiver, a scripter, a...



It's a cross between Glade / Visual Studio — the idea is that most 'action' code for an application is actually quite simple - so entering the code on the event handlers for a widget makes the proximity of code to action better.




Smooth online creator. Zero technical knowledge required. Many features for creating your dream apps. IOS, Android and Webapp created in just one go.
eMobc is a framework to develop multiplatform native mobile apps in IOS, Android and HTML5 based in XML.
Native apps from one code base:
Unlike other cross-platform technologies, Tabris can be used to create native, platform-specific interfaces from one Java code base. The resulting apps render native widgets on each target platform, while the application logic is all Java and rema.




JCppEdit v3.8 is a multiple programming language IDE that offers you a unique platform to code many programs in a single environment, starting from C, C++, Java to HTML, CSS, JavaScript, XML and Text files.




MobAppCreator is a self-service mobile application platform. In just minutes, you can create a fully functional iOS app without technical knowledge.
